Iraqi - Yugoslavia approach
Iraq-Yugoslavia, Politics, 4/26/1999

Iraq and Yugoslavia decided to raising the level of diplomatic representation between them to the ministers level soon.

Anas Carabo Khitsh, the Yugoslavia charge d'affairs in Baghdad, described this step as a part of the Iraqi stance supporting Yugoslavia against the military operations launched by the US and NATO.

The Yugoslav diplomat described the Iraqi position of being among the clearest supporting Yugoslavia.

Meanwhile, Iraqi newspapers resumed their campaign against air raids by NATO aircraft on vital targets in Yugoslavia, saying that the goal of these military operations is war and not protecting Kosovo's Muslims as NATO has said.

Al-Thawra newspaper, which speaks for the ruling Baath party in Iraq, said that, "Yugoslavia is the target in the air campaign which does not follow U.S.A and does not consider belong to N.A.T.O." The paper said the issue is political and not moral, and they want to divide Yugoslavia into as small of and geographical units as possible.
